Juba, August 2, 2019 (SSNA) — Reeling under systemic tribalism, endemic corruption and chronic civil wars, South Sudan the world and Africa’s newest independent nation has found itself in a death kneel’s dilemma out of which several political parties have tried their fairs of rough hands to deliver it.

With exception of South Sudan National Democratic Alliance, SSNDA of which UDRM/A is the member that has come out with practically innovative ideas in its revolutionary manifesto to ensure more than fifty years’ state of anarchy is brought to its ultimate end.

In a week-long serialization beginning Monday 5th and ending Sunday 11th of August 2019, Deng Vanang as the party’s Secretary-General will candidly carry you through UDRM/A’s summarized unique portions of manifesto that makes the party stand out tall and proud from its peers as  the lasting solution to the problematic cocktail of power greed, blinding ethnicity and impoverishing corruption  which together conspired to bring down once-promising country now writhing in pain of indignity and shame right in the eyeball of the bewildering world.
